Description
Brass fittings, including spring check valves, are essential components in connecting and adapting piping and tubing systems across various industrial applications. Their primary function is to ensure secure joints, maintain flow continuity, and support the safe operation of systems by preventing backflow. Commonly used in compressed air lines, water supply systems, gas distribution, hydraulic equipment, and industrial process piping, these fittings offer significant advantages such as exceptional strength, corrosion resistance, reliable sealing, and a long service life. Applications
- Used in compressed air systems to prevent backflow and maintain system pressure.
- Essential in water distribution networks to ensure one-way flow and prevent contamination.
- Critical component in gas supply lines to enhance safety by preventing reverse flow.
- Applied in irrigation systems to maintain consistent water delivery and prevent siphoning.
- Integral to plumbing installations for preventing backflow in residential and commercial applications.
- Utilised in industrial process piping to protect equipment from reverse flow and pressure surges.
- Implemented in heating systems to ensure efficient flow and prevent system damage.
- Commonly found in fuel lines to maintain proper fuel delivery and prevent backflow issues.
